Travel Price Index for May 2007 increased 3.5 percent year-over-year
The Travel Industry Association of America said the . Hotel and motel prices were up 4.5 percent and the cost for "food away from home" rose by 3.3 percent. Airline fares, however, dropped one percentage point from May 2006. TIA's TPI "measures the seasonally unadjusted inflation rate of the cost of travel away from home in the United States." By comparison, the Consumer Price Index in May increased 2.7 percent.
